Error in Figure

In the original publication [1], there was a mistake in Figure 1d as published. The sequences KY418873 and KF530568 from Cyptotrama asprata (Berk.) Redhead & Ginns and Xerula strigosa Zhu L. Yang, L. Wang & G.M. Muell. respectively were erroneously noted by symbol ⚫︎. The corrected Figure 1d appears below.
Jof 09 01189 i001

Text Correction

There was an error in the original publication. We did not include acknowledgment to Carlos Roberto Silva Moraes. A correction has been made to Acknowledgments.
Acknowledgments: The authors thank Alexandro Andrade and Jefferson Góis for the initial taxonomic support, Suzana Ehlin Martins for the taxonomic identification of the host plant, Dimitrios Floudas for suggesting the Greek prefix of the new generic name and also for helping to compose the etymology of the new genus, Carlos Roberto Silva Moraes (also known as Duco) for granting us access to the collection site, and the anonymous reviewers for improvements to the original manuscript. We are also grateful to “Fundação Florestal” and “Secretaria do Meio Ambiente do Estado de São Paulo” for the collection licenses (process #260108-010.245/2017).
The authors apologize for any inconvenience caused and state that the scientific conclusions are unaffected. The original publication has also been updated.
